Needham Market FC Captain Reflects on a Remarkable Season: A Bright Future Ahead
In an inspiring reflection on the 2025/26 campaign, Needham Market FC captain Keiran Morphew proudly acknowledges the significant strides the club has taken, despite narrowly missing out on the Pitching In Southern League Premier Central play-offs due to goal difference. Remarkable Performances and Milestones
The captain took pride in the outstanding performances delivered by the squad during the season, noting that they achieved their second-highest finish at Step 3.
